you are valid!

Something that was really helpful to me was realizing that it’s okay to not remember exactly what was said or what happened, and that what matters is how you felt. Hold onto how you felt, because that is what makes you valid. I found this to be especially helpful as it relates to trauma. I can’t remember some details of my traumatic experiences and that doesn’t make me any less valid! I remember how bad I felt and that is what validates that something wrong happened.
